3-Day Road Trip: Hyderabad → Annavaram → Simhachalam (Visakhapatnam) → Vijayawada — Temples, Coast & Culture

Viewed by 326 travelers

Day 1: Drive & Temples

Hyderabad to Vijayawada, India on October 24, 2025

7:00am

Depart Hyderabad

Start early from Hyderabad to avoid city traffic and make good time on NH65/NH16 toward Vijayawada; total driving time ~4.5–5.5h depending on stops.
INR0, 5h0m

8:00am

Breakfast — Chutneys or Highway Dhaba

Stop for a hearty South Indian breakfast (idli, dosa, pesarattu) at a clean highway or city outlet; good to fuel up for the drive and sample Andhra/Telugu breakfast flavours.
INR200, 45m

12:30pm

Arrive Vijayawada & Lunch — Local Andhra Thali

Arrive Vijayawada and have a spicy, local Andhra thali at a recommended mid-range restaurant near the station or MG Road for authentic flavours and quick service.
INR350, 1h0m

2:00pm

Kanaka Durga Temple

Visit the famous hilltop Kanaka Durga Temple overlooking the Krishna River — a major religious site and panoramic viewpoint; temple generally open in morning and evening (confirm darshan slot locally).
INR0, 1h0m

3:30pm

Prakasam Barrage & Bhavani Island (boat if available)

Walk along Prakasam Barrage for river views and head to Bhavani Island for a short boat ride (boat services typically 9:00am–5:30pm) or relax by the riverbank.
INR150, 1h0m

5:30pm

Check-in & Rest

Check into your Vijayawada hotel and rest or freshen up before evening activities; choose a hotel near MG Road or the station for convenience.
INR2000, 1h0m

7:30pm

Dinner — Vijayawada Seafood or Andhra Restaurant

Try local Andhra-style seafood or spicy vegetarian specialties at a popular city restaurant; evening is a good time to sample Andhra biryani or prawn curry.
INR400, 1h0m

9:00pm

Overnight in Vijayawada

Relax at your hotel; prepare for early start the next day to visit Annavaram and continue to Visakhapatnam.
INR0, 9h0m

Day 2: Annavaram & Simhachalam

Vijayawada → Annavaram → Visakhapatnam (Simhachalam), India on October 25, 2025

5:30am

Depart Vijayawada for Annavaram

Early departure to reach Annavaram in the morning when temple crowds are manageable; drive time ~2–2.5h (approx 120–140 km).
INR0, 2h30m

8:00am

Breakfast en route or packed

Either grab a quick breakfast at a clean highway outlet (idli/dosa/chai) or eat a packed breakfast to arrive early at the temple for darshan.
INR150, 30m

9:00am

Sri Veera Venkata Satyanarayana Swamy Temple, Annavaram

Visit the hill-top Annavaram temple (well known for its gopuram and panoramic views); typical darshan windows start early—plan for 1–2 hours including queue and circumambulation.
INR50, 1h0m

11:00am

Drive to Visakhapatnam

Continue northeast toward Visakhapatnam (approx 1.5–2.5h depending on traffic, ~90–130 km); enjoy coastal scenery as you approach the city.
INR0, 2h0m

1:30pm

Lunch — Coastal Andhra / Seafood in Vizag

Arrive in Visakhapatnam and have lunch at a well-reviewed coastal Andhra restaurant to sample seafood specialties or local vegetarian meals.
INR450, 1h0m

3:00pm

Simhachalam Temple (Sri Varaha Lakshmi Narasimha)

Visit the famous Simhachalam temple on the hill near Vizag — important Vishnu shrine with strong local devotion; typical visiting hours include a morning and an evening slot (commonly 6:00am–12:30pm and 3:00pm–8:30pm), so plan afternoon/evening darshan accordingly and follow dress/camera rules.
INR0, 1h0m

5:00pm

Check-in Vizag hotel & sunset at RK Beach

Check into your hotel in Visakhapatnam, then head to RK Beach for a relaxed sunset stroll and views of the lighthouse promenade.
INR1500, 1h30m

8:00pm

Dinner — Beachfront Seafood or Andhra Cuisine

Enjoy fresh seafood or traditional Andhra dishes at a popular beachfront or city restaurant; try prawn curry, fish fry, and coconut-based curries.
INR500, 1h0m

10:00pm

Overnight in Visakhapatnam

Rest up for a full day of Vizag sightseeing tomorrow or prepare for return drive depending on your preference.
INR0, 8h0m

Day 3: Vizag Sights & Return

Visakhapatnam → Vijayawada (end) / India on October 26, 2025

7:00am

Early Morning — Kailasagiri

Visit Kailasagiri hill park for panoramic coastal views, ropeway (operates roughly 9:00am–6:00pm) and large displays; great for photos and a calm morning walk (park typically open 8:00am–8:00pm).
INR100, 1h0m

8:30am

Breakfast — Local Bakery or Seafront Café

Light breakfast at a café near the beach or Kailasagiri — try local pastries, fresh juice or upma/idli if you prefer a hearty start.
INR200, 30m

9:30am

INS Kurusura Submarine Museum & Visakha Museum

Explore the INS Kurusura (submarine museum) on RK Beach (usually open around 10:00am–5:00pm) and the nearby Visakha Museum for naval and regional history; both give a good sense of Vizag's maritime heritage.
INR200, 1h30m

11:30am

Rushikonda Beach (optional water sports)

Head to Rushikonda Beach for clearer waters and optional water sports (jet-skiing/banana boat) — operators typically run 9:00am–5:00pm; otherwise relax on the sand and take photographs.
INR500, 1h0m

1:00pm

Lunch — Popular Vizag Restaurant

Have lunch at a popular local restaurant; try thali or seafood again if you enjoyed it yesterday, or try regional vegetarian dishes like gongura pachadi with rice.
INR400, 1h0m

2:30pm

Depart Visakhapatnam for Vijayawada

Begin the drive back to Vijayawada (approx 5.5–7h depending on traffic and stops, ~350 km); leave by mid-afternoon to arrive before late night.
INR0, 6h30m

8:30pm

Arrive Vijayawada & Dinner

Arrive back in Vijayawada for dinner — opt for a quick meal near the highway or at your preferred restaurant in the city before concluding the trip.
INR350, 1h0m

10:00pm

Trip End — Overnight or onward travel

Conclude your 3-day loop; either overnight in Vijayawada or continue onward to Hyderabad by train/road the next morning depending on your schedule.
INR0, 8h0m
